Missouri HB3138 mandates the creation of a missing persons unit in police departments in counties with over one million inhabitants.
Missouri HB3138 amends Chapter 85, RSMo, by adding a new section, 85.705, which requires police departments in counties with more than one million inhabitants to establish a missing persons unit. This unit will provide services to aid in locating missing persons, including coordinating and investigating reports, collecting and disseminating information, and establishing a communication system for missing persons. The unit will also coordinate with the Missouri state highway patrol's missing persons unit.
